Star World has shown the entire 5 seasons of Downton Abbey in weekday format and it's drawing to a really interesting conclusion. The writing is excellent and the performances strong- the icing on the cake has to be those delectable shots of grand castles against the English countryside. For someone who's pretty fascinated by the writings of Wodehouse and Conan Doyle (set approximately around the same period) to see characters from that era come to life, warts and all, is fascinating. I was a late adopter (incidentally member subodh got me hooked onto this around S2 of this showing) but can't wait for this to end so that I can watch it from the beginning again, probably a binge watch during those summer weekends when it's too hot to go anywhere!
The characters are beautifully fleshed out, in all their brilliant grey shades and the language is a joy to listen to in this age of SMS lingo. Am a big fan.
